sql >> Database >  >> RDS >> Sqlserver

Verbinding met SQL Server werkt soms

Het bleek dat TCP/IP was ingeschakeld voor het IPv4-adres, maar niet voor het IPv6-adres van THESERVER .

Blijkbaar hebben sommige verbindingspogingen IPv4 gebruikt en andere IPv6.

Het inschakelen van TCP/IP voor beide IP-versies loste het probleem op.

Dat SSMS werkte bleek toeval (de eerste paar pogingen waren vermoedelijk IPv4). Enkele latere pogingen om verbinding te maken via SSMS resulteerden in dezelfde foutmelding.

Om TCP/IP in te schakelen voor extra IP-adressen:

  • Start Sql Server Configuration Manager
  • Open het knooppunt SQL Server-netwerkconfiguratie
  • Links klikken op protocollen voor MYSQLINSTANCE
  • Klik in het rechterdeelvenster met de rechtermuisknop op TCP/IP
  • Klik op Eigenschappen
  • Selecteer het tabblad IP-adressen
  • Zorg voor elk vermeld IP-adres dat Actief en Ingeschakeld beide Ja zijn.


  1. Hoe gegevens exporteren als CSV-indeling van SQL Server met behulp van sqlcmd?

  2. Hoe kan ik een lijst met parameters ophalen uit een opgeslagen procedure in SQL Server?

  3. Sql Server Service Broker-gespreksgroepen

  4. Hoe gebruik ik Psycopg2's LoggingConnection?